93 MX-3 V6 hesitation issue(edited 7/15/12)
Posted: April 16th, 2012, 10:05 pm
i have a 1993 mx-3 GS v6 5 speed
it has had an engine swap by a previous owner with a K8 from an automatic.
ive cleaned the TB and MAF and replaced the fuel filter.
the engine starts fine. and can be driven pretty normally. until you step on the gas harder then if your driving like a grandma
if i am in 2nd gear at 2000rpm and i punch the gas. All i get is stumble stumble stumble until i let off the gas.
if you learn the gas pedal and EASE into driving you can drive pretty fine. this happens in all gears and all RPM ranges.
(edit)
After taking what you guys have said and figuring out how to get the CEL codes myself here is where we stand.
1long 7 short, 2 long 9 short, 4 long 6 short
17 LHO2S inversion error
29 EGR vent solenoid
46 VRIS #2 solenoid
